The collection is both diverse and expansive, including historic artifacts, antiques, fine art, and western home furnishings. Our store, located in scenic Coeur d’Alene, Idaho, is filled from floor to ceiling with pieces that spark romantic tales of the western frontier. Cisco’s inventory of authentic Native American art and artifacts is among the finest in the world featuring Navajo rugs, baskets, beadwork, totems, pipes, southwest jewelry and more! Cisco’s art collection includes original paintings and bronzes from famous western artists, ranging from
just-plain-folky to investment quality. Our home furnishings are both antique and contemporary, featuring custom-made furniture suitable for modern western homes.
